Best First Cars for Beginners

If you’re learning to drive or have just passed your driving test, you may be wondering what car to purchase. When choosing a car, there are many factors to consider. Your budget should be the first thing you should consider when deciding what kind of car you should consider. To help you narrow down your choices, below is a list of affordable and suitable cars for beginners. 

Citroen C1

The Citroen C1 is a popular choice for first-time drivers. It’s a small car that can fit up to four people. Although it may look small from the outside, it’s relatively spacious and has stylish interiors too. Another benefit of choosing this car is that it’s cheap to insure, which is a bonus for anyone on a tight budget.

Fiat 500

The fiat 500 is another excellent option for beginners. Built in 1957, it has a unique exterior, and it’s one of the smallest cars available out there. Not only does it look trendy, but it’s also cheap to run. It’s not the cheapest car in the market. However, the price is still affordable. 

Peugeot 107

Another affordable and reliable option to buy is the Peugeot 107. It’s a small city car with an economical engine which means it’s cheap to run. It’s also easy to drive, making it an ideal purchase for first-time drivers.

Toyota Aygo

Toyota Aygo has the same similarity as Peugeot 107 and Citroen C1. It comes with a small engine, is easy to drive around, and has a cheap insurance cover. The insurance can cost roughly around £600-£700, which is very affordable.

Volkswagen Up!

The Volkswagen Up is the smallest car ever made by Volkswagen. It’s a slim car that’s perfect to drive around the city. It offers a spacious boot as well as cheap consumables. The only downside of this car is that it’s not as cheap to insure compared to the vehicles mentioned above.
